Hi Fern,

Well, the existence of an afterlife is a topic of interest to just about every person on the planet, for the simple reason that all of us leave it during a process known as death.

Death is not an easy subject for a lot of people, but the more I study it, the more I realize that it is more of a study of life, rather than what we consider to be the end of anything. It's very helpful to me, personally, to know more about it, because any difficult situation seems easier when a person is more knowledgeable about it.

It is also a great way to be exposed to many different cultures' views on a variety of subjects, because the subject of life and death touches everyone in so many different ways.

Additionally, every person brings their own unique viewpoint to their studies. You may find a particular viewpoint which is helpful, not only to you, but to others.

One thing to remember is something which we occasionally mention on this forum. That is that it is very difficult to "prove" something to someone else. It is easier to prove that something is very very likely, from all the evidence gathered, but you are the only one who can really prove something to you.
